Dr. Robyn Mobbs is an Assistant Teaching Professor at University of Colorado Denver School of Public Affairs, where she directs the Bachelor of Arts in Public Administration program and leads the Center on Network Science.
Education includes:
- PhD in Public Affairs from University of Colorado Denver
- MBA from University of Southern Queensland, Australia
- BA in Political Science from University of Colorado Boulder
Her teaching focuses on leadership, negotiation, collaboration, and ethics in public administration. Research examines negotiation dynamics, cross-sector collaboration, and organizational effectiveness in public health and social service networks. She applies network science to understand partnership effectiveness in public systems.
As Fulbright Scholar at University of Hong Kong (2015-16), she advanced research on cross-cultural collaboration. Her work has been supported by Robert Wood Johnson Foundation and national public health research centers.
